Step 3: After drilling and mounting firewall, mount
slider bracket to firewall or side structure, bolt 
E-brake assembly to firewall mount slider brack-
et and slide into desired location. Now install 
the front slider bracket to the main frame in 
order to locate the dash mounting bracket. The 
dash mounting bracket has a curved slot in it to 
allow for many different dash angles. The dash 
mounting bracket comes with three mounting 
holes for mounting to the back of the dash. 
However, one mounting bolt to the dash is suf-
ficient. When looking at the footbrake assembly 
from the driver’s position, the right hand dash 
mounting bracket hole can also be used to 
mount the release rod mounting bracket. Two 
1/4-28 x 5/8" allen bolts and nylocks are pro-
vided to mount the dash mounting bracket and 
the release rod mounting bracket.
Step 4: Once dash mounting bracket and firewall mount
slider bracket have been mounted and main 
frame is in position, the L-shaped release rod 
can be cut-to-fit. Slip the footbrake release 
knob through the release rod mounting bracket, 
install release rod spring, and adjust nut up 
just enough to take the slack out and put some 
tension on the release rod spring. Release rod 
spring must not be loose. Line up release rod 
level with footbrake release knob and mark and 
cut with a hack saw.

Step 5: Before final installation of release rod, remove main
frame assembly from mounting brackets and remove 
main frame cover. Now install Lokar Connector Cable, 
(Part No. EC-8001U Black housing or EC-8001HT 
Stainless housing; Not included with footbrake kit.) 
NOTE: Housing of brake cable must be cut to length 
before inner wire installed. Once cable is installed, 
replace main frame cover. Assemble using the 
5/16-24 nylock nuts and dispose of the non-locking 
nuts. Do not over tighten assembly. Over tightening 
can distort assembly and bind pedal. Run connector 
cable under vehicle and install Lokar emergency brake 
cables to rear brakes. To look up the correct part 
number for your application, check www.lokar.com.
